Y214 WSW is a 2001 Daihatsu Fieldman in Green with a 2,765c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2001 Daihatsu Fieldman models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.2% with a typical mileage of 88,326 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Daihatsu Fieldman f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 4,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y214 WSW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daihatsu Fieldman typ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 25 years old, this Daihatsu Fieldman is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
